The Magic of Pure Cooperative Storytelling
Some of the finest gaming moments come from titles built entirely around two players working toward a singular goal. Games like It Takes Two offer a masterpiece of collaborative mechanics where unique puzzle challenges require constant communication and synchronicity to progress. This approach keeps both participants equally involved, ensuring that neither player feels left behind or secondary to the main action.
Another excellent option for narrative-driven couples is A Way Out, which delivers a thrilling cinematic escape story told entirely through a forced split-screen perspective. Navigating these tightly woven plotlines together fosters deep coordination and triggers genuine discussions about strategy and timing. These experiences provide a balanced environment where players can bond naturally over shared victories and dramatic story revelations.
Chaotic Culinary Management and Fun Challenges
If you prefer fast-paced gameplay that tests your ability to handle hilarious pressure, time management simulators offer endless entertainment. Overcooked All You Can Eat combines multiple cooperative classic campaigns into one definitive package filled with wacky obstacles and dynamic kitchens. Success in these environments relies entirely on division of labor, making it a fantastic tool for practicing teamwork in a playful setting.

Immersive Sandboxes and Relaxing Worlds
For a more laid-back interactive date, exploring expansive sandbox worlds at your own pace offers a highly therapeutic alternative. Building a digital homestead together in Minecraft allows you to divide tasks creatively, with one person managing agriculture while the other focuses on grand structural architecture. The lack of strict timelines creates a welcoming atmosphere where you can chat comfortably and customize your virtual environment without stress.
If your partner appreciates deep atmosphere and mystery, sailing together across the beautiful but unpredictable waters of Sea of Thieves offers a grand sense of nautical freedom. Managing a shared ship requires both players to look after different stations, from steering the wheel to adjusting the sails for maximum wind efficiency. This style of casual exploration allows couples to set their own goals and enjoy breathtaking virtual vistas together.
